The purpose of this thread is to call the attention of the Founder of Nairaland, Mr Seun Osewa over his decision to 'ban' the promotion of Biafran agitation on Nairaland.com. As most of us know, Rule 9 has been amended by the owner to reflect on the ban. Quoting the rule... 9. Don't use Nairaland for illegal acts, e.g scams, plagiarism, hacking, gay meetings, incitement, promoting Biafra. Though I am neither an Igboman nor one of the promoters of Biafra, I couldn't help but express displeasure in the rule because it violates Article 2 of United Nations Resolution on Self Determination (1960) , Sections 35, 39 and 42 of the Constitution of Nigeria and also is in conflict with the principle of Social justice. For avoidance of doubt, article 2 of the UN Resolution on Self-Determination states that... All peoples have the right to self- determination; by virtue of that right they freely determine their political status and freely pursue their economic, social and cultural development. It clearly states that people should FREELY determine their status and freely pursue it. The decision of Mr Seun has contravened this paragraph and it is not something we should celebrate. Furthermore, Nigeria Constitution guarantee some rights to every citizen and group. Some of which include; 1. Right to personal liberty (Section 35): Every person is entitled to personal liberty. 2. Right to freedom of Expression (Section 39): Right to freedom of expression and the press is very fundamental to the sustenance of democracy 3. Right to freedom from discrimination (Section 42): No citizen of Nigeria shall be discriminated against on the basis of his community, ethnic group, place of origin, sex, religion or political opinion All the aforementioned rights have been taken away by the amended rule 9 of Nairaland.com. Additionally, the decision of Mr Seun also contravenes the principle of social justice. For avoidance of doubt, Social justice principle is of the view that everyone deserves equal economic, political and social rights and opportunities. While I have been at the receiving end of some pro- Biafran promoters in terms of insults and abuse, it won't make me to support what I know is against their fundamental right as Nigerians and citizens of the world. It will be more appropriate for the moderators to take down content by agitators of Biafra that promotes hate, violence and support arson. However, they deserve the right to be expressive. Those of us that believe in Nigeria will not hesitate to engage promoters of Biafra movement intellectually when opportuned. Yes, we love promoters of Biafrans and some people don't want the Igbo nation or any other nation to secede but it is inappropriate to shut their voices. We have to uphold the tenet of democracy in promoting our unity. May God Bless Us All and Bless Nigeria. 5 Likes 2 Shares |
